Hellbound ... a South Korean series on Netflix from the bloke wot did zombie flick Last Train To Busan. This time it's ghostly apparitions announcing the time of death of "sinners", followed by three demons that appear at the annointed hour to smite the doomed. The story focuses less on the nasties and more on the effect this has on society. Only 6 episodes, so it doesn't drag, but it's not a very light-hearted affair, and not for the faint of heart. --Geoff
